What is WebSocket and why do I need it?

This article will briefly describe what WebSocket is, and why Valotalive has chosen to use this technology

Technically speaking, WebSocket is a communication protocol that provides a full-duplex bi-directional communication channel between a client and a server over TCP.
​
What this means for you is that the Valotalive displays are always online and get real time data, eliminating continuous polling and page reloads. This reduces network load. If WebSocket is unsupported by network components, the player defaults to polling.
​
The key benefits of utilizing this technology are:

  • Keep your teams informed in real time

  • Enjoy a better user experience

    • Commands and interaction with Valotalive are real-time

  • Allows Valotalive a strong foundation for further development
